finally: why evolution absolutely without question HAS to be true

In the September/October issue of Archaeology, I read what may be the single most important reason for why human evolution simply has to be true! In a ground-breaking article, Zach Zorich–whose name will henceforth be sung in praise by all the faithful–shows that evolution makes baseball possible. Let me repeat: without evolution, there is no baseball. [Read More…]

Mariano Rivera: A Likely Goodbye to A True Hero

Michael Mercer, over at Internet Monk, posted today a wonderful piece on a man I have admired for the past 17 years, Yankees reliever Mariano Rivera. It is a great post, and reading it took me back for a few minutes….. I stopped having sports heros sometime during high school–mainly because I aspired to be one myself. [Read More…]